Global Military Navigation Market size was valued at USD 10.8 Billion in 2024 and is poised to grow from USD 11.54 Billion in 2025 to USD 19.68 Billion by 2033, growing at a CAGR of 6.9% during the forecast period (2026-2033).
The global military navigation market is witnessing robust growth, driven by the critical need for reliable positioning solutions in contemporary combat scenarios. Militaries worldwide are prioritizing investments in GNSS-INS hybrid systems and secure navigation frameworks to navigate challenges posed by GPS-denied environments. The upgrade of legacy systems across aerospace, land, and naval platforms to next-generation navigation technologies is enhancing accuracy, redundancy, and AI-enabled decision-making. North America remains a leader in military navigation expenditure, propelled by modernization efforts in UAVs, aircraft, and terrestrial vehicles. Meanwhile, the Asia-Pacific region is rapidly expanding its military navigation capabilities amid rising geopolitical tensions. Innovations include miniaturized sensors and advanced jam-resistant technologies, fueling market growth despite ongoing challenges related to research costs and integration hurdles.

Global Military Navigation Market Segments Analysis
Global Military Navigation Market is segmented by Platform, System, Application, Component, Grade, End-User and region. Based on Platform, the market is segmented into Aviation, Ammunition, Marine, Ground, Space and Unmanned Vehicle. Based on System, the market is segmented into Inertial Navigation Systems (INS), Global Navigation Satellite Systems (GNSS) Receivers, Inertial Measurement Units (IMUs), Attitude and Heading Reference Systems (AHRS) and Combined GPS/INS (GINS) Systems. Based on Application, the market is segmented into Command & Control, Intelligence, Surveillance & Reconnaissance (ISR), Combat & Security, Targeting & Guidance and Search & Rescue (SAR). Based on Component, the market is segmented into Hardware, Software and Service. Based on Grade, the market is segmented into Navigation Grade, Tactical Grade, Space Grade and Marine Grade. Based on End-User, the market is segmented into Army, Navy, Air Force and Space Force. Based on region, the market is segmented into North America, Europe, Asia Pacific, Latin America and Middle East & Africa.

Market Trends of the Global Military Navigation Market
The Global Military Navigation market is experiencing a notable trend towards miniaturization and the reduction of Size, Weight, Power, and Cost (SWaP-C) in navigation systems. This progression enables the integration of advanced navigation capabilities into compact platforms, including small UAVs, guided munitions, and even individual soldier equipment. Emerging technologies, particularly MEMS-based inertial measurement units, are being developed to deliver high-performance navigation in compact, chip-sized formats. This shift not only enhances operational efficiency but also broadens the application of sophisticated navigation systems across various military platforms, positioning SWaP-C optimization as a pivotal driver of growth in the military navigation sector.
